bluebell -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 :

  Harebell \Hare"bell`\ (h[^a]r"b[e^]l`), n. (Bot.)
     A small, slender, branching plant (Campanula rotundifolia),
     having blue bell-shaped flowers; also, Scilla nutans, which
     has similar flowers; -- called also bluebell. [Written also
     hairbell.]
     [1913 Webster]
  
           E'en the light harebell raised its head. --Sir W.
                                                    Scott.
     [1913 Webster]

  Bluebell \Blue"bell`\, n. (Bot.)
     (a) A plant of the genus Campanula, especially the
         Campanula rotundifolia, which bears blue bell-shaped
         flowers; the harebell.
     (b) A plant of the genus Scilla (Scilla nutans).
         [1913 Webster]

bluebell - WordNet (r) 2.1 (2005) :

  bluebell
      n 1: sometimes placed in genus Scilla [syn: wild hyacinth,
           wood hyacinth, bluebell, harebell, Hyacinthoides nonscripta
           , Scilla nonscripta]
      2: one of the most handsome prairie wildflowers having large
         erect bell-shaped bluish flowers; of moist places in prairies
         and fields from eastern Colorado and Nebraska south to New
         Mexico and Texas [syn: prairie gentian, tulip gentian,
         bluebell, Eustoma grandiflorum]
      3: perennial of northern hemisphere with slender stems and bell-
         shaped blue flowers [syn: harebell, bluebell, Campanula   rotundifolia
         ]
